1. The kinetic energy of a 2510 kg truck at 42 km/h is closest to ___?
2. A crate is released from the highest point of a 4.00 m long ramp inclined at 60 degrees with the horizontal. The motion is frictionless. What is the speed of the crate at the base of the ramp?
3. The potential energy of a 72 kg student at the second floor, 5.5 m from the ground is __?
4. A worker pushes a wheelbarrow with a force of 180 N making a 25 degree angle with the direction of motion. The work done by the worker on the wheelbarrow is 7140 J. What distance did the worker push the wheelbarrow?
5. An arrow is released from a bow at 62 m/s with a kinetic energy of 103 J. The mass of the arrow is then
6. A constant 38 N net force acts for 1.50 m on a 9.00 kg object initially at rest. What is the object's final speed?
7. A spring with k=15 N/cm is compressed by x=0.075 m. The elastic potential energy stored in the spring is then __?
8. How much work does a 750 W engine do in 18 hours?
9. A 2400 kg pick up truck accelerates, from rest, reaching 60 mph is 45 s. The power delivered by the engine is nearest __ W.
10. An 85 kg student climbs, at a constant speed, a flight of stairs from the ground floor to the first floor, 5.5 m above. The work done by the force of gravity on the student is __ J.
11. A car travels at 15 m/s constant speed. The engine delivers a power of 2730 W. The total force of resistance acting on the car is then __.
